Claims
- 1. A new water-insoluble polymeric composition having polythiaacetal-ketal linkages therein, of the formula: ##STR21## wherein: R.sub.1 and R.sub.4 are independently selected from the group consisting of hydrogen and a monovalent residue of monomercaptans and monoalcohols, said monovalent residue that forms terminal groups being present in the statistical average polymer chain at least to about 50 mole percent of the terminal groups, and R.sub.1 and R.sub.4 are not both hydrogen in the statistical average polymer chain; R.sub.2 and R.sub.3 are independently selected from the group consisting of hydrogen and perchlorocarbyl and chlorohydrocarbyl radicals each having from 1 to 10 carbon atoms. X.sub.1, X.sub.2, X.sub.3 and X.sub.4 being independently selected from the group consisting of sulphur and oxygen with at least 30 mole percent of sulfur present in the total selection; A is the divalent residue of the compounds selected from the group consisting of dimercaptans, monomercapto alcohols and diols; and n is an integer from 2 to 50; said monovalent residue selected from the group consisting of primary alkyl, thia-alkyl, oxa-alkyl, aralkyl, alkenyl and mixtures thereof; and said divalent residue selected from the group consisting of primary alkylene, thia-alkylene, oxa-alkylene, aralkylene, and mixtures thereof.
- 2. The composition of claim 1 in which the divalent residue is derived from a dimercaptan having from 4 to 20 carbon atoms.
- 3. The composition of claim 1 in which the divalent residue is derived from a monomercapto alcohol having from 4 to 20 carbon atoms.
- 4. The composition of claim 1 in which the divalent residue is derived from a diol having from 4 to 20 carbon atoms.
- 5. The composition of claim 1 in which the monovalent residue is derived from a monoalcohol having from 7 to 20 carbon atoms.
- 6. The composition of claim 1 in which the monovalent residue is derived from a monomercaptan having from 7 to 20 carbon atoms.
- 7. The composition of claim 1 in which is the liquid phase reaction product of a mercaptan, an aldehyde, and a diol.
- 8. The composition of claim 1 which is the liquid phase reaction product of a mercaptan, an aldehyde, and a dimercaptan.
- 9. The composition of claim 1 which is the liquid phase reaction product of a mercaptan, an aldehyde, and a monomercapto alcohol.
- 10. The composition of claim 1 which is the liquid phase reaction product of mercaptan, a ketone, and a diol.
- 11. The composition of claim 1 which is the liquid phase reaction product of mercaptan, a ketone, and a dimercaptan.
- 12. The composition of claim 1 which is the liquid phase reaction product of mercaptan, a ketone, and a monomercapto alcohol.
- 13. The composition of claim 7 in which the aldehyde is paraformaldehyde.
- 14. The composition of claim 10 in which the ketone is acetophenone.
- 15. The composition of claim 1 in which diol moiety in the polymer chain is not greater than 50% by weight of dimercaptan and 25% by weight of monomercapto alcohol.
